The Maruti Suzuki Victoris is one of the most-awaited compact SUVs launched in India in 2025. This SUV comes with multiple engine choices, including petrol, strong hybrid, and CNG. It offers advanced features like Level 2 ADAS, a premium sound system, and a spacious cabin, making it a popular choice in its segment.

Price Overview
- The Victoris is priced between ₹10.49 lakh to ₹19.99 lakh (ex-showroom). The on-road prices vary depending on city, but generally range from around ₹12 lakh to ₹22 lakh. There are six main variants, each offered with different fuel types and transmission options.
- Key Points About the Variants
- LXi is the base variant, available in petrol manual and CNG manual.
- VXi comes with more features, available with petrol manual, petrol automatic, strong hybrid, and CNG manual options.
- ZXi and its optional (O) sub-variant offer premium features with petrol manual and automatic, and strong hybrid.
- ZXi Plus and ZXi Plus (O) are the top trims, offering AWD (All-Wheel-Drive) options and the most advanced safety and technology features.
- Hybrid and CNG versions provide options for efficiency and lower running costs.
Features Highlight
- Level 2 ADAS safety features for assisted driving.
- Infinity Harman Dolby Atmos premium audio system with eight speakers.
- 10.25-inch fully digital instrument cluster.
- Multiple powertrain choices: petrol mild hybrid, strong hybrid e-CVT, and S-CNG.
- Spacious interior based on the popular Grand Vitara platform.
- Bharat NCAP 5-star safety rating.
